About the Job

The Director, Strategic Operations & Enablement is an action-oriented leader, strategic thought partner to FMI stakeholders, and a driver of innovative solutions that bring lasting value to the organization and to our BioPharma partners. The Director develops and drives cross-functional initiatives supporting best-in-class customer experience, leads prioritization, and mobilizes others to optimize BioPharma's operational and financial capabilities.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ead cross-functional initiatives and improvements that have significant impact on BioPharma achievement of OKRs. · Lead and drive Strategic Operations activities with Marketing & Training, Product Innovation and Roche Diagnostics Team
  • Partner with Marketing & Training team to build analytical solutions and incorporate market intelligence to help enable lead targeting strategy and launch strategies
  • Partner with Product Innovation to build solutions to help facilitate preparation for product development stages and approvals, in addition to understanding the quantifying market landscape and opportunities
  • Partner with Roche Diagnostics to build an integrated competitive and market intelligence capabilities, and solutions determining the impact of external events on the biopharma portfolio.
  • Contribute to development of Business Insights and Enablement strategy and delivery
  • Develop, maintain, and scale critical business processes on behalf of the BioPharma business unit
  • Build and leverage relationships with key stakeholders across the organization to identify opportunities for operational/process improvements ensuring a smooth customer experience
  • Own implementation of solutions to inefficient processes and workflows, contributing directly to achieving organizational goals
  • Understand key business measures and align with collaborators across FMI to develop KPIs and tracking mechanisms; regularly identify opportunities for growth and efficiency
  • Partner with insights and analytics teams to interpret voice-of-customer insights and translate into transformative initiatives improving customer satisfaction
  • Drive operational excellence and integration of best practices across BioPharma and the broader FMI organization
  • Develop dashboards to track customer experience initiatives.
  • Facilitate the evolution of business systems and platforms (e.g., Salesforce)
  • Partner with customer-facing teams to build robust dashboards and interfaces capturing account-level data
  • Serve as a mentor for other team members
  • Other duties as assigned

Qualifications:

Basic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ree in business or scientific discipline or additional relevant experience
  • 12+ years of experience in process excellence or business operations in biotechnology, biopharma, or a similar setting

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Undergraduate degree in a life science
  • Master of Business Administration Degree or graduate degree in a relevant discipline
  • Management consulting experience
  • Experience:
    • leading, handling-and mobilizing multiple partners (including top executives) and demands in a dynamic change orientated environment
    • strategizing, designing, and executing towards departmental goals
    • generating creative new approaches to solving business problems
    • driving collaborative successes with limited mentorship
  • Excellent communication skills in presenting complex concepts to both executive leadership and operational teams
  • Superior problem solving and analytical skills, takes a data-driven, analytical approach to draw upon business insight where information is incomplete
  • Self-motivated and independently results-oriented as demonstrated history of, and interest in, driving business impact in a highly autonomous role
  • Understanding of HIPAA and the importance of patient data privacy
  • Commitment to reflect FMI's Values: Passion, Patients, Innovation, and Collaboration
